OSCimpulsesc Series: Exploring Advanced Oscilloscope Techniques
Hey guys! Ever wondered how to truly unlock the power of your oscilloscope? Today, we’re diving deep into the OSCimpulsesc series, a set of advanced techniques that will take your signal analysis skills to the next level. Forget just seeing waveforms – we're talking about understanding them, diagnosing problems*, and optimizing your circuits like never before. This series is designed for engineers, hobbyists, and anyone who wants to go beyond the basics and become a real oscilloscope master. So, buckle up, and let's get started!
Understanding the Basics of Oscilloscopes
Before we jump into the advanced stuff, let's quickly recap the fundamentals. An oscilloscope, at its heart, is a voltage-measuring instrument that displays signals as a waveform on a screen. The horizontal axis represents time, and the vertical axis represents voltage. Pretty straightforward, right? But the magic lies in how we use this information. The oscilloscope allows us to measure various parameters of a signal, such as amplitude, frequency, pulse width, and rise time. These measurements are crucial for troubleshooting electronic circuits and understanding their behavior. Now, imagine you're working on a complex embedded system. You need to ensure that the timing of different signals is precise for the system to function correctly. An oscilloscope can help you visualize these signals and measure the time intervals between them. If there's a delay or timing mismatch, you can quickly identify the source of the problem using the oscilloscope's measurement capabilities. Understanding the basic controls of an oscilloscope is also essential. The vertical scale (volts/division) determines the voltage range displayed on the screen, while the horizontal scale (time/division) determines the time range. Adjusting these scales allows you to zoom in on specific parts of the waveform and examine them in detail. Triggering is another crucial concept. It determines when the oscilloscope starts displaying the waveform. Proper triggering ensures a stable and clear display, especially for repetitive signals. Without proper triggering, the waveform may appear to drift or be difficult to interpret. You can choose different trigger sources, such as the input signal itself or an external signal. For example, if you're analyzing a digital signal, you can trigger on the rising or falling edge of a clock signal. This will synchronize the display with the clock, making it easier to examine the data being transmitted. In addition to basic measurements, oscilloscopes also offer advanced features such as cursors and markers. Cursors allow you to measure voltage and time differences between two points on the waveform, while markers can be used to highlight specific events or regions of interest. These features can greatly simplify complex measurements and help you identify subtle anomalies in the signal.
Diving into Advanced Triggering Techniques
Okay, now we’re getting to the good stuff! Advanced triggering is where the OSCimpulsesc series really shines. Forget simple edge triggering – we're talking about pulse width triggering, logic triggering, and even serial bus triggering. These techniques let you isolate specific events in complex signals, making troubleshooting a breeze. Pulse width triggering, for example, allows you to trigger on pulses that are within a certain time range. This is incredibly useful for identifying glitches or missing pulses in digital circuits. Imagine you're debugging a communication protocol where each data bit is represented by a pulse. If a pulse is too short or too long, it can cause errors in the data transmission. Pulse width triggering allows you to isolate these faulty pulses and pinpoint the source of the problem. Logic triggering takes it a step further by allowing you to trigger on specific combinations of logic signals. This is invaluable for debugging digital systems with multiple inputs and outputs. For example, you might want to trigger when a certain address is being accessed on a memory bus. Logic triggering allows you to set up a trigger condition based on the state of the address lines, so you can capture the relevant data and analyze the memory access pattern. And then there's serial bus triggering, which is a game-changer for anyone working with serial communication protocols like I2C, SPI, or UART. Instead of manually decoding the serial data, the oscilloscope can automatically decode it for you and trigger on specific data patterns or addresses. This greatly simplifies the process of debugging serial communication links and identifying communication errors. For example, if you're debugging an I2C interface, you can set the oscilloscope to trigger when a specific device address is being accessed. The oscilloscope will then decode the data being transmitted and display it in a human-readable format, making it much easier to identify communication problems. In addition to these advanced triggering techniques, some oscilloscopes also offer zone triggering. This allows you to define a specific region on the screen and trigger only when the signal enters or exits that zone. Zone triggering can be useful for isolating intermittent events or capturing rare glitches in the signal. By combining these advanced triggering techniques, you can effectively isolate and analyze specific events in complex signals, greatly simplifying the troubleshooting process and improving your understanding of the system's behavior.
Mastering Signal Processing and Analysis
The OSCimpulsesc series isn't just about seeing signals; it's about understanding them. Signal processing and analysis are crucial for extracting meaningful information from waveforms. We're talking about Fast Fourier Transforms (FFTs), filtering, and mathematical operations that reveal hidden details. The Fast Fourier Transform (FFT) is a powerful tool for analyzing the frequency content of a signal. It transforms a time-domain signal into a frequency-domain representation, showing the amplitude of each frequency component. This is incredibly useful for identifying noise sources, harmonics, and other unwanted signals. For example, if you're experiencing interference in your circuit, you can use the FFT to identify the frequency of the interfering signal. This can help you track down the source of the interference and implement appropriate filtering or shielding measures. Filtering allows you to remove unwanted frequency components from a signal. This can be useful for reducing noise, isolating specific signals, or shaping the frequency response of a circuit. Oscilloscopes typically offer a variety of filter types, such as low-pass, high-pass, band-pass, and band-stop filters. For example, if you're analyzing a low-frequency signal that's corrupted by high-frequency noise, you can use a low-pass filter to remove the noise and improve the signal clarity. Mathematical operations allow you to perform calculations on the waveform data. This can be useful for measuring power, calculating derivatives, or performing other complex analysis. Oscilloscopes typically offer a range of mathematical functions, such as addition, subtraction, multiplication, division, integration, and differentiation. For example, if you're analyzing the current and voltage waveforms of a power supply, you can use mathematical operations to calculate the instantaneous power and average power. In addition to these basic signal processing techniques, some oscilloscopes also offer advanced analysis features such as histograms, parameter extraction, and jitter analysis. Histograms allow you to visualize the distribution of signal values, which can be useful for identifying statistical anomalies or characterizing the noise performance of a circuit. Parameter extraction allows you to automatically measure key parameters of the signal, such as rise time, fall time, pulse width, and frequency. Jitter analysis allows you to measure the timing variations in a digital signal, which can be critical for high-speed communication links. By mastering these signal processing and analysis techniques, you can extract valuable information from waveforms, diagnose problems more effectively, and gain a deeper understanding of the behavior of your circuits.
Advanced Oscilloscope Features and Applications
Let's explore some more advanced features and applications that the OSCimpulsesc series can unlock. We're talking about segmented memory, mask testing, and remote control capabilities that can revolutionize your workflow. Segmented memory allows you to capture multiple waveforms in quick succession and store them in separate memory segments. This is incredibly useful for capturing intermittent events or analyzing sequences of signals. For example, if you're debugging a control system, you can use segmented memory to capture the response of the system to different input commands. This allows you to analyze the system's behavior under various conditions and identify any performance issues. Mask testing allows you to define a tolerance region around a known-good waveform and automatically flag any signals that deviate from the mask. This is invaluable for production testing and ensuring the quality of manufactured devices. For example, if you're manufacturing amplifiers, you can use mask testing to ensure that the amplifier's output signal meets the specified performance requirements. Any amplifier that produces a signal that falls outside the mask can be automatically rejected, preventing defective products from being shipped to customers. Remote control capabilities allow you to control the oscilloscope from a computer or other device, enabling automated testing and data acquisition. This is particularly useful for long-term monitoring or unattended testing scenarios. For example, if you're monitoring the performance of a power grid, you can use remote control to automatically collect data from the oscilloscope and analyze it in real-time. This allows you to detect potential problems early on and take corrective action before they escalate into major outages. In addition to these features, some oscilloscopes also offer specialized application software for analyzing specific types of signals, such as power signals, automotive signals, or communication signals. These software packages often include pre-defined measurements, templates, and analysis tools that simplify the process of analyzing these specialized signals. By leveraging these advanced features and applications, you can greatly enhance your productivity, improve the accuracy of your measurements, and gain a deeper understanding of the behavior of your circuits and systems.
Tips and Tricks for Effective Oscilloscope Usage
Alright, guys, let's wrap things up with some tips and tricks for getting the most out of your oscilloscope and truly mastering the OSCimpulsesc series. First, always use the correct probe. A mismatched probe can significantly affect your measurements. Make sure your probe's bandwidth is sufficient for the signals you're measuring. Secondly, minimize ground loops. Ground loops can introduce noise and distortion into your measurements. Use short ground leads and avoid creating large loops in your test setup. Proper grounding is crucial for accurate and reliable measurements. Thirdly, calibrate your oscilloscope regularly. Calibration ensures that your oscilloscope is measuring accurately. Follow the manufacturer's instructions for calibrating your oscilloscope. Fourthly, take advantage of the oscilloscope's built-in help system. Most oscilloscopes have extensive help documentation that can guide you through the various features and functions. Don't be afraid to consult the manual or online resources for assistance. Fifthly, practice, practice, practice. The more you use your oscilloscope, the more comfortable you'll become with its features and functions. Experiment with different settings and techniques to develop your skills. Sixthly, share your knowledge. The oscilloscope community is a great resource for learning and sharing tips and tricks. Participate in online forums, attend workshops, and share your experiences with others. Seventh, understand your signal. Before you even connect your probe, try to understand the characteristics of the signal you're measuring. What's the expected frequency range? What's the expected amplitude? Having a good understanding of the signal will help you choose the appropriate settings and interpret the results. Finally, document your work. Keep a record of your test setups, settings, and results. This will help you reproduce your measurements later and track your progress over time. By following these tips and tricks, you can improve the accuracy and reliability of your measurements, streamline your troubleshooting process, and become a true oscilloscope master. The OSCimpulsesc series is your gateway to unlocking the full potential of your oscilloscope and taking your signal analysis skills to the next level. So, get out there, experiment, and have fun!